允许提醒事项使用位置老是提醒:手机系统及应用权限的深度解析247


很多朋友都遇到过这样的困扰:明明已经允许某个应用访问手机的地理位置,却仍然不断弹出“允许[应用名称]使用位置”的提醒。这不仅烦人,更让人怀疑手机系统或应用是否存在问题。 事实上,导致此类情况的原因多种多样,并非简单的权限设置问题,需要我们从系统底层、应用逻辑以及权限管理机制等多个角度进行分析。

首先,我们需要了解手机系统是如何管理应用位置权限的。安卓和iOS系统虽然各有不同,但核心机制都大同小异:当一个应用需要访问位置信息时,它会向系统发出请求。系统会弹出权限请求对话框,用户可以选择“允许”或“拒绝”。 “允许”意味着系统授予该应用访问位置信息的权限;“拒绝”则意味着该应用无法获取位置信息。 然而,“允许”并非一劳永逸,系统及应用内部的机制会根据多种情况再次触发权限请求。

1. 系统级的权限管理机制: Android系统和iOS系统都内置了较为复杂的权限管理机制。为了保护用户隐私和安全,系统会对应用的位置权限进行动态监控和管理。有些情况下,即使你已经允许应用使用位置,系统仍然可能出于以下原因再次请求权限:
系统升级或更新: 系统更新后,可能会重置部分应用的权限设置,导致应用再次请求权限。
应用更新: 应用更新后,也可能需要重新获取位置权限,特别是涉及到位置功能更新的版本。
长时间未访问: 某些系统为了安全起见,会根据应用长时间未访问位置信息的情况,再次请求权限确认。
特殊情况:例如,应用在后台运行时,系统为了安全考虑,可能会再次提示权限请求,或者当系统检测到应用行为异常时,也可能重新评估权限。
权限重置: 用户或系统可能主动或被动地重置了应用的权限设置,例如清除应用数据、恢复出厂设置等。

2. 应用自身逻辑: 除了系统级的权限管理,应用自身的逻辑也可能导致权限反复请求。一些应用为了确保位置服务的可用性,会在后台定期检查位置权限,或者在特定场景下(例如启动导航、发送位置信息等)重新请求权限。 这并非一定是应用的bug,而是为了保证功能正常运行的设计。

3. 应用的后台定位机制: 很多应用即使在后台运行,也需要持续访问位置信息,例如一些运动类应用、地图导航应用等。 这就需要应用获得“后台位置权限”,而这种权限的请求往往更加严格,系统也会给出更频繁的提醒。 用户可能需要在系统设置中手动开启后台位置权限。

4. 位置权限的类型: 不同类型的应用可能需要不同类型的定位权限。例如,一些应用只需要粗略的位置信息(例如城市级别),而另一些应用则需要精确的位置信息(例如经纬度)。 应用会根据自身需求请求相应的权限,如果用户只授权了粗略位置信息,而应用需要精确的位置信息,则会再次请求权限。

解决“允许提醒事项使用位置老是提醒”的问题,可以尝试以下方法:
检查应用权限设置: 进入手机设置,找到应用管理,选择有问题的应用,查看其位置权限是否被授予,并检查是否开启了“后台位置权限”。
更新应用: 更新到最新版本的应用,可能修复了导致权限反复请求的bug。
清除应用数据: 清除应用数据可能会重置应用的权限设置,但请注意,此操作会清除应用中的所有数据。
重启手机: 重启手机可以解决一些临时性的系统问题,有时能有效缓解此类问题。
卸载并重新安装应用: 如果以上方法无效,可以尝试卸载并重新安装应用。
检查系统设置: 查看系统的位置服务是否开启,以及是否有相关的系统设置影响了应用的位置权限。
关注应用的隐私政策: 仔细阅读应用的隐私政策,了解应用如何使用位置信息,这有助于判断应用是否过度索取位置权限。

总而言之,“允许提醒事项使用位置老是提醒”并非单一原因导致,需要结合系统机制、应用逻辑以及用户操作进行综合分析。 通过以上方法排查,大部分问题都能得到解决。 如果问题仍然存在,建议联系应用开发者寻求帮助,或者咨询手机厂商的客服。

2025-05-18


上一篇:华为手环7日程提醒功能深度解析及设置技巧

下一篇:摇号提醒短信:功能、设置与防范诈骗指南